In politics, news Rams owner doesn’t pick a favorite
Lots of chatter today in sports circles about what the new Rams owner, Dale “Chip” Rosenbloom, will do after his team’s abysmal start to the season.
If his political contributions are any indication, Rosenbloom will play it safe.
Rosenbloom, a Hollywood producer who inherited the team from his late mother, Georgia Frontiere, has given the legal maximum — $2,300 — to both Republican John McCain and Democrat Barack Obama.
According to the Center for Responsive Politics, Rosenbloom has made about $17,000 in campaign contributions since 2000, with no apparent partisan favor — previously, he’s supported Hillary Clinton, Rudy Giuliani and even Ralph Nader.
At least by backing both McCain and Obama for the White House, he’s guaranteed to have a win — which is more than can be said for the Rams this year.
